| 正面描述 | Uniformed bust of King Rama X (Maha Vajiralongkorn) facing slightly left, depicted in military dress adorned with decorations and insignia, rendered in high relief with fine portrait detail. The effigy occupies the majority of the obverse field, with the King's short hair and formal attire conveying regal authority. A curved Thai-script legend arcs along the left and right periphery, reading the full royal name and title of His Majesty King Maha Vajiralongkorn Phra Vajira Klao Chao Yu Hua. |

Rama X — King Vajiralongkorn — ascended the throne in 2016 following the death of his father Bhumibol Adulyadej, who had reigned for 70 years and was among the longest-serving monarchs in modern history. The 72nd birthday carries specific cultural weight in Thai tradition: three complete 12-year cycles of the lunar zodiac, a threshold considered auspicious and marking a man's entry into the final stage of life's great divisions.
